Psalms 3:6

3:6 I am not afraid of the multitude of people

who attack me from all directions.

Psalms 144:13

144:13 Our storehouses will be full,

providing all kinds of food.

Our sheep will multiply by the thousands

and fill our pastures.


tn The imperfect verbal form here expresses the psalmist’s continuing attitude as he faces the crisis at hand.

tn Or perhaps “troops.” The Hebrew noun עָם (’am) sometimes refers to a military contingent or army.

tn Heb “who all around take a stand against me.”

tn The Hebrew noun occurs only here.

tn Heb “from kind to kind.” Some prefer to emend the text to מָזוֹן עַל מָזוֹן (mazonal mazon, “food upon food”).

tn Heb “they are innumerable.”

tn Heb “in outside places.” Here the term refers to pastures and fields (see Job 5:10; Prov 8:26).
